A fresh influx of the Pfizer vaccine means that Mississauga and Brampton residents will be able to choose their medicine when they get their shots.

Peel Public Health says that moving forward; residents will be allowed to choose their vaccine brand – either Pfizer or Moderna – when they arrive at any clinic where doses are being administered to combat COVID-19.

This is a departure from just one month ago when residents were told that most second doses would be Moderna because of the short supply of Pfizer.
